In this masterpiece of sports reportage, Washington Post staff writer Mark Maske--one of the most respected journalists working both on and off the field--draws on unprecedented access to produce a behind-the-scenes look at the NFL's bitterest rivals: the Philadelphia Eagles, New York Giants, Washington Redskins, and Dallas Cowboys. Relentlessly reported from the leadership level, War Without Death delivers all the dramatic personality conflicts and unexpected changes in personnel and fortune, creating a complete narrative of four intensely competitive organizations locked in a steel-cage match with each other over the course of a year--nothing less than nirvana for sports fans.… (més)

There was some interesting information presented, especially in semiprivate NFL dealings that most of us average joes never hear about, but like others said in reviews, there is wayyyyy to much time spent on owner negotiations and meetings and labor disputes and not enough on the side of the NFL we really care about (the football). I found myself skimming or even skipping entire paragraphs or half pages and don't feel like I missed anything important. The premise was there and had it been executed better, it could have been dynamite, instead, it was more sparkler. ( )

One of the better books on pro football that I've read. While it's true, little of the information is new to those who followed the NFC during the 2006 season, it's still a great read for the memories and the little stuff. I like how it bounced back and forth between individual team issues at particular times i.e. the draft, free agency, particular games on their schedule to whole league issues -- the labour agreement and revenue sharing.

It allowed the reader to get into the season without getting bogged down in too many detauls that would made it too dense of a read. I like the discussion of the salary cap -- especially how the players' salaries are counted against the cap and how there is wiggle room within the cap to make moves. Interesting to see Parcells' take on TO and Vanderjagt - yes the author didn't like Dallas but with Dallas playing at the Meadowlands, I got *my* Parcells from the days of him here with LT, Simms, etc.

Interesting to see how frequently some of these issues come up and now a year + into Goodell's tenure as commissioner and with the recent death of Upshaw. ( )
